Many people enjoy the solitude and primitive experience of camping away from developed campgrounds and other campers. Dispersed camping is the term used for camping anywhere in the National Forest outside of a designated campground. Dispersed camping means no toilets, no treated water, and no fire…

Complete silence in the mountains!
Stayed 7/15/20 - FREE
I turned down road 464 and found a spot to the left, after a rough little dip(in a sedan).
I was coming from Wyoming and 464 was not too far past Mirror Lake Campground and just before Lilly Lake, on the right.
